Seven Wonders of the World.




The New 7 Wonders of the World have been
announced during the Official Declaration ceremony in Lisbon, Portugal on
Saturday, July 7, 2007 - 07.07.07.



Taj Mahal of Agra, India 1.Taj Mahal of Agra, IndiaThe Taj Mahal in Agra, India, which was
built by fifth Mughal emperor shah Jahan to honour the memory of his beloved
wife Mumtaz Mahal in 1630 AD;



Pyramid at Chichen, Itza, Mexico




2.Pyramid at Chichen, Itza, MexicoThe pyramid at
chichen itza, which is the remains of the most famous Mayan temple city that
served as the political and economic center of Mayan civilization inyucatan
peninsula, Mexico, built around 500 AD;

Machu Pichu,Peru
3.Machu Pichu,PeruThe Machu Picchu,a city built in the clouds on
the mountain in cuzco, peru between 1640 and 1470 AD;


4.Statue of Christ the Redeemer, Brazil

4.Statue of Christ the Redeemer, BrazilThe Christ Redeemer ,a
38-meter tall statue of Jesus Christ atop the Corcovado mountain in rio de
Janeiro,brazil, built in 1931 AD;


5.Great wall of China
5.Great wall of ChinaThe graet wall of china, constructed to link
existing fortification into a united defence system and keep invading mongal
tribes out of china, built in 220 BC and 1368 to 1644 AD;


 6.Roman colosseum, Italy

6.Roman colosseum, ItalyThe roman colosseum, which is a great
amphitheatre in the center of rome, italy, constructed to celebrate the glory of
the roman empire, built between 70 and 82 AD;


Ruins of Petra, Jordan

7.Ruins of Petra, JordanThe petra, which was once the capital
of the nabataean empire of king aretas IV, built from 9BC to 40 AD in Jordan.
